Eight papers, in the order they were written. Each one is here in full — main text, figures with commentary, and the supplementary audit layer that records how every number was checked and what was later corrected.

These are workbench documents. This site is a record of a workbench, not a record of finished results. Rigorous standards were applied to the arXiv paper alone.

Paper 1
Packet Centroids
A Smoothing Identity and a Displacement Sum Rule
The framework and the census. Partial sums of ζ travel in packets; each packet's centroid misses ζ by a computable amount. Two theorems, a seven-window census, and the spacing statistics that started everything.

Paper 2
Packet Centroids II
The Fresnel Mechanism, Coil Geometry, and Zero Conditions of the Partial-Sum Walk
What the error term actually is, measured to a parameter-free prediction, plus the coil law and the first structural obstruction: every line-selective invariant of the walk turns out to be deterministic.

Paper 3
Packet Centroids III
The Aperture-Crop Law, Carrier Dynamics, and the Euler-Product Stem
Small-value geometry. How close ζ comes to zero on a fixed line, why one close pair of zeros governs it, and the first construction in the programme that separates ζ from its counterexample by using multiplicativity at step one.

Paper 4
Packet Centroids IV
The Spectral-Dual Support Law, the Prime-Steering Bridge, and the Primitivity Frame
The counterexample put under the instruments as the measured object. A zero set reads its own coefficient arithmetic back, to 12–14 digits, on five different constructions.

Paper 5
Packet Centroids V
The Per-Event Witness Law, the Three-Register Count, and the Measured Gap
An exact per-event law of the critical line — and the same motion that proves it exact shows it cannot do the job, for a reason that is measured rather than asserted.

Paper 6
Packet Centroids VI
The Multiplicativity Dial, the Value Region, and the Shape of What Is Missing
A controlled experiment on the Euler-product boundary, run on a family that crosses it continuously. It returns a clean null — and corrects two of the programme's own conclusions.

Paper 7
Packet Centroids VII
The Positivity Register — What an Inequality Can and Cannot See
Weil and Li positivity, calibrated against certified counterexamples for the first time. It detects the class from the sign of one eigenvalue, then prices itself out of the only use that would have mattered.
